Abstract

With the development of computer network, there are more and more multimedia real-time transmission methods. The traditional stand-alone multimedia synchronization method is unable to solve out of the sync problems due to the unstable factors in the network transmission. Therefore synchronization method for streaming media communication research is very important. RTP and RTCP protocol is geared to the needs of multimedia network transmission and development, on the application of RTP and RTCP protocol has many places worthy to be discussed. Based on the multimedia real-time network of RTP and RTCP protocol the implementation of the specific researches are studied, and in a local area network environment the tested conclusions are given.
